The function of the chordae tendineae is to limit the freedom of motion of the cusps of the av valves (tricuspid and mitral), limiting their capacity to flap back into the corresponding atrium. The role of the chordae tendineae is to anchor the av valves against the large pressure changes that occur as the ventricles contract.
